Great to have you here and curious to know who's behind all this! I’m Sandra Kolondam, the creative mind behind ZOOZANY – bringing you my illustrative, painterly, and often humorous animal world.
Painting animals is the culmination and essence of a long artistic journey that I have been on for many years. It may sound simple, but sometimes the most obvious things are the hardest to find.
I have been passionate about drawing and painting for as long as I can remember. Many years ago, I completely changed my life: I quit my job in marketing management, studied painting and devoted myself entirely to art. My journey of discovery took me through various styles - from large-format works to a wide variety of themes and abstraction. But I always returned to what had inspired me as a child: nature and the world of animals.Today, I combine this passion with the knowledge I have gained over the years in painting, techniques and materials and also with humor.
As the daughter of a German mother and an Indonesian father, I grew up biculturally and also have a great enthusiasm for the tropical forests of our planet. Lush green vegetation bursting with life and its inhabitants - whether in reality or in mythological tales - inspire me time and time again.
My studio is located in Tiefenbach, just outside Landshut. Here I work together with my husband Klaus Soppe, who is also a freelance painter. With the inspiring city of Landshut, the home of my grandmother and her siblings, the Isar river and the beautiful countryside behind me, I find everything I need for my creative work.
